Before Age of Ultron, Marvel had tested the waters with Hindi dubs for The Avengers (2012) and Captain America: The Winter Soldier. However, the reception was mixed. The translations were often too literal, losing the punch of Tony Stark’s sarcasm or Thor’s Shakespearean gravitas.
With Avengers: Age of Ultron, Marvel India and their dubbing partners (primarily Sound & Vision India and Mandar Khanolkar’s team) decided to go all-in. They created not just a translation, but a localized adaptation—replacing English colloquialisms with Hindustani idioms, adding punchlines that landed better with desi audiences, and casting voice actors who sounded like the actual stars. The biggest risk in dubbing comedy is losing the joke. Age of Ultron has several rapid-fire exchanges (especially between Tony and Bruce). The Hindi track wisely replaces Western pop-culture references with more neutral or universally funny alternatives. For instance, a reference to a obscure American TV show becomes a sarcastic remark about a character’s ego—something any Indian viewer understands.
Emotional scenes, like Clint Barton’s (Hawkeye) speech about his family farm, are translated with remarkable sensitivity. The line “She’s all I ever needed” becomes “Woh meri duniya hai” (She is my world)—a phrase that carries deep romantic and familial weight in Hindi cinema.
